HarmonyOS 鸿蒙Next 地图API无法使用

发布于 1周前 作者 caililin 来自 鸿蒙OS

HarmonyOS 鸿蒙Next 地图API无法使用

开发使用地图api始终收到报错信息:the map permission is not enabled
【我的项目】->【项目设置】->【API管理】中,定位服务、位置服务、地图服务都已经设置为开启

2 回复
应该是您没有开通地图服务权限。您可以参考此文档,https://developer.huawei.com/consumer/cn/doc/harmonyos-guides-V5/map-config-agc-V5#section16133115441516  检查AppGallery Connect网站上是否开通地图权限。权限开通存在延迟,如未生效,请稍后重试。

更多关于HarmonyOS 鸿蒙Next 地图API无法使用的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


针对您提到的HarmonyOS 鸿蒙Next地图API无法使用的问题,以下是一些可能的解决方案:

  1. 权限检查: 确认您的应用已正确申请并获得了使用地图API所需的权限。在鸿蒙系统的manifest文件中检查相关权限声明是否完整。

  2. API版本匹配: 检查您使用的地图API版本是否与鸿蒙Next系统兼容。有时候,新系统可能不支持旧版本的API,需要更新到最新版本。

  3. 依赖库更新: 确保您的项目中引入了正确版本的地图服务依赖库。如果依赖库版本过旧,可能无法与新系统兼容。

  4. 服务配置: 检查鸿蒙系统的服务配置,确保地图服务已正确启用并运行。有时服务未启动或配置错误也会导致API无法使用。

  5. 代码实现: 检查调用地图API的代码实现,确保遵循了鸿蒙系统的调用规范。错误的调用方式可能导致API无法正常工作。

  6. 系统日志: 查看系统日志,了解地图API调用失败的具体原因。系统日志通常能提供详细的错误信息,有助于定位问题。

如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html

回到顶部